Probiotics: What Science Really Says About These Popular Supplements
Probiotics have surged in popularity, finding their way into yogurts, fermented foods, and supplement aisles. Labels often promise “digestive balance,” “immune support,” or even “mood enhancement.” While these claims are appealing, it’s important to distinguish between regulatory structure-function statements permitted under DSHEA and effects that are scientifically validated. As a pharmacist, I approach probiotic supplementation with both caution and clarity, providing guidance rooted in clinical evidence.
Understanding Probiotics
Probiotics are live microorganisms, typically bacteria or yeasts, that, when consumed in adequate amounts, may confer health benefits. The most common bacterial genera found in supplements include Lactobacillus and Bifidobacterium, while Saccharomyces boulardii is a well-studied yeast probiotic.
A key point often overlooked is strain specificity. Not all probiotics provide the same benefits, and research demonstrates that effects are highly dependent on the exact species and strain. Simply counting the total colony-forming units (CFUs) is not sufficient; the clinical outcomes are tied to the particular strains included.
Probiotics are generally marketed with claims like “supports digestive health” or “boosts immunity,” which are considered structure-function claims. These statements do not require clinical proof under DSHEA. Understanding what the science actually shows can help you make informed decisions.
Evidence-Based Health Applications
Digestive Health
Clinical trials support the use of specific probiotic strains for digestive conditions. For example, certain Lactobacillus and Bifidobacterium strains can reduce symptoms of irritable bowel syndrome, including bloating, gas, and discomfort. Saccharomyces boulardii has been shown to prevent or shorten the duration of antibiotic-associated diarrhea. While beneficial, probiotics are not a cure-all; their effects tend to be modest and are most effective for targeted conditions.
Immune Support
Some probiotics can modulate the immune system. Strains like Lactobacillus rhamnosus GG may reduce the incidence and severity of respiratory infections, particularly in children or individuals with low baseline immunity. The mechanisms involve interactions with gut-associated lymphoid tissue, but benefits are strain-specific and not universal.
Mood and Cognitive Health
Emerging research suggests a link between the gut microbiome and brain function, sometimes referred to as the gut-brain axis. Certain probiotics may influence neurotransmitter production or reduce inflammation that affects the central nervous system. While preliminary studies indicate potential mood or cognitive benefits, this area remains experimental, and broad claims such as “enhances memory and focus” are not supported for the general population.
Women’s Health
Probiotic supplementation may also support vaginal and urinary tract health. Strains like Lactobacillus reuteri and Lactobacillus rhamnosus can help maintain healthy vaginal flora, potentially reducing the risk of recurrent bacterial vaginosis or urinary tract infections. Again, the benefit is highly strain-dependent.
Optimizing Probiotic Efficacy
Probiotics are fragile. Exposure to heat, moisture, and stomach acid can reduce the number of live organisms reaching the intestines. Choosing the right formulation is critical:
- Enteric-Coated Capsules: These protect probiotics from stomach acid, ensuring more organisms survive to reach the intestines.
- Shelf-Stable Strains: Some formulations use naturally hardy strains that remain viable at room temperature, avoiding the need for refrigeration.
- Microencapsulation: This advanced delivery system encases probiotics in protective materials to enhance survival through the digestive tract.
Always read storage instructions and choose products from reputable brands that provide third-party testing for potency and purity. This helps ensure the label accurately reflects the CFU count and strain composition.
Dosage Considerations
Effective probiotic dosing varies widely depending on the strain and intended health benefit. General adult recommendations typically range from 1 billion to 10 billion CFUs per day, though higher doses may be used for specific conditions under professional supervision.
Unlike vitamins or minerals, more is not always better with probiotics. Excessive CFU counts do not guarantee superior results and may increase the risk of mild gastrointestinal side effects, such as bloating or gas. The key is to match the strain and dose to the specific health goal.
Safety and Potential Interactions
Probiotics are generally well tolerated in healthy adults. Most adverse effects are mild, including temporary digestive discomfort when starting supplementation.
Certain populations should exercise caution:
- Individuals with weakened immune systems or severe illness may be at risk of infection from live organisms.
- People with central venous catheters or critically ill patients should consult a healthcare provider before use.
- Mild interactions may occur with some medications or medical conditions, so professional guidance is recommended.
Overall, probiotics have a strong safety profile when used appropriately, but personalization is key.
